`

Javascript时间比较

阅读更多

//startdate和enddate的格式为:yyyy-MM-dd hh:mm:ss
//当date1在date2之前时,返回1;当date1在date2之后时,返回-1;相等时,返回0
function datecompare(date1, date2){
	var strdt1=date1.replace("-","/");
  	var strdt2=date2.replace("-","/");   
  
    var d1 = new Date(Date.parse(strdt1));
    var d2 = new Date(Date.parse(strdt2));
    if(d1<d2){
        return 1;
    } else if ( d1>d2 ){
    	return -1;
    } else{ 
    	return 0;
    } 
}
//将当前时间格式化为:yyyy-MM-dd hh:mm:ss
function formatCurrDate(){
	var objDate=new Date();	//创建一个日期对象表示当前时间
	var year=objDate.getFullYear();   //四位数字年
	var month=objDate.getMonth()+1;   //getMonth()返回的月份是从0开始的,还要加1
	var date=objDate.getDate();
	var hours=objDate.getHours();
	var minutes=objDate.getMinutes();
	var seconds=objDate.getSeconds();
	return year+"-"+month+"-"+date+" "+hours+":"+minutes+":"+seconds;
}
1
0
分享到:
评论
1 楼 huqiji 2011-07-06  
没     用     的

相关推荐

    javascript 时间比较实现代码

    在Web开发中,对时间进行比较是一个常见的需求,尤其是需要用户输入开始时间与结束时间进行验证的场景。由于不同的浏览器和输入格式可能...这种时间比较的实现方式简单而有效,适用于大多数需要时间比较功能的Web应用。

    时间日期JavaScript 选择时间日期

    常见的JavaScript日期库如moment.js、date-fns和luxon等,提供了更强大和灵活的日期处理功能,包括复杂的日期格式化、解析、比较和计算。 以上就是JavaScript处理日期和时间的一些核心知识点,这些在日常Web开发中...

    javascript时间控件

    JavaScript时间控件是一种在网页上实现用户交互式时间选择功能的工具,通常用于表单输入或者日历插件等场景。这种控件允许用户通过图形界面来选择或输入时间,而不是传统的文本输入框,提高了用户体验和数据准确性。...

    javascript 日期时间控件

    JavaScript 日期时间控件是一种在Web应用程序中用于用户交互式选择日期和时间的组件。它通常以日历或时钟的图形用户界面呈现,提供了一种直观且易于使用的交互方式,使得用户能够方便地输入或选择日期和时间值。在这...

    javascript时间显示各种特效

    本文将围绕“javascript时间显示各种特效”这一主题,详细讲解JavaScript在处理时间显示上的常见技巧和特效。 1. **时间格式化**: JavaScript中的Date对象是处理日期和时间的基础。我们可以使用`Date()`构造函数...

    javascript时间特效

    javascript时间特效

    一个时间选择的JavaScript

    通过阅读这篇博客,我们可以获取到关于该JavaScript时间选择器的实现细节和实际应用。 标签“源码”意味着这个压缩包可能包含了实现该时间选择器的源代码。源码是程序员可以查看、修改和学习的原始代码,对于开发者...

    使用javascript实时显示系统当前时间

    ### 使用JavaScript实时显示系统当前时间:深入解析与实践 在现代网页开发中,实时更新页面元素,如显示当前时间,是提升用户体验的关键技术之一。本文将深入探讨如何使用JavaScript实现这一功能,包括代码细节、...

    javascript的时间拾取器

    JavaScript时间拾取器是一种常用的前端开发工具,它允许用户在网页上方便地选取时间,类似于我们在许多应用程序中看到的日历和时钟组件。这个工具文件是JavaScript编程语言实现的,适用于那些需要用户输入时间的场景...

    javascript写的时间,直接引用即可

    通过分析这个文件,我们可以学习到更多关于JavaScript时间处理的实际应用。 总之,JavaScript的时间处理功能强大且灵活,无论是获取、格式化还是计算时间差,都有相应的方法可以实现。通过熟练掌握这些知识,你将...

    js日期时间控件 JavaScriptjs日期时间控件 jsp

    JavaScript日期时间控件是网页开发中常用的一种组件,主要用于用户在网页上选择或输入日期和时间。在JavaScript中,处理日期和时间的核心对象是`Date`。本篇将深入探讨JavaScript日期时间控件的实现原理、使用方法...

    用javascript写选择日期时间的例子

    在JavaScript中,处理日期和时间是一项常见的任务,无论是用于用户界面中的输入验证,还是在后台进行数据处理。本文将深入探讨如何使用JavaScript编写一个选择日期和时间的示例,包括基本的日期对象操作、自定义日期...

    使用javascript显示当前时间

    使用javascript显示当前时间

    Javascript时间 倒数器的代码与实现

    JavaScript时间倒计时器是一种常见的前端开发功能,用于显示特定日期或时间点之前的剩余时间。在网页中,这种倒计时器通常用于促销活动、竞赛结束或者重要事件的预告等场景。下面我们将深入探讨如何使用JavaScript来...

    javascript 时间滑动条

    JavaScript时间滑动条是一种用户界面元素,用于让用户以直观的方式选择或输入时间。它通常包含一个可拖动的滑块,表示时间的流逝,而滑块的位置则对应于特定的时间值。这种控件在需要用户指定时间范围或者精确时间点...

    JavaScript最简单比较两个时间格式数据的大小.zip

    在JavaScript中,比较两个时间格式的数据大小是一项常见的任务...了解这些基础知识,可以帮助你在实际项目中更有效地处理时间比较问题。这个压缩包中的文件很可能提供了具体的示例代码,你可以下载并学习,以加深理解。

    javascript实时显示北京时间的方法

    本文实例讲述了javascript实时显示北京时间的方法。分享给大家供大家参考。具体如下: 该页面中实时显示北京时间,更改时区也可以作为显示世界时间,代码如下: 复制代码 代码如下:[removed] Date.prototype....

    点击输入框就出来时间的JavaScript

    点击输入框就出来时间的JavaScript 很好用

    JavaScript-时间模块

    JavaScript时间模块是编程中不可或缺的一部分,它主要用于处理与时间相关的操作。在JavaScript中,我们可以创建、格式化、比较以及操作日期和时间。本课堂案例将深入探讨JavaScript的时间管理功能,帮助你更好地理解...

    javascript时间转换源代码

    JavaScript时间转换源代码是用于处理和格式化日期与时间的代码片段,它允许开发者将时间数据转换为不同的格式,以满足各种应用场景的需求。在Web开发中,JavaScript是客户端编程的主要语言,因此掌握时间处理技巧...

Global site tag (gtag.js) - Google Analytics